A Windsor woman behind a complaint with the City of Windsor's integrity commissioner is offering an apology.
Dee Sweet had launched the complaint against Mayor Drew Dilkens claiming comments he made at a news conference in May about the proposed mega hospital project on County Rd. 42 and the 9th concession were misleading.
She received a response from Integrity Commissioner Bruce Elman, but misintrepreted the response as the complaint being dismissed, when in fact, it was not.
"I, as an everyday citizen, interpreted this as meaning this complaints were dismissed," she wrote in an email to AM800 News.
She also wrote an email to council Friday morning but Elman has clarified with her, that the complaint has not been dismissed and she should correct any false impression.
